WEST HAVEN -- Those who wish to be buried in West Haven will soon be able to.
In April, the city bought ground at 2350 W. 1600 South for its first cemetery and is currently rough-grading the land for use. The cemetery ground was originally a big pit, but after removing trees and moving dirt, it will be suitable for burials.
The work is still in beginning stages, and there is no date set for when the public can buy plots.
